Transaction 80bb192d04370398f64dd37a4be8fa72f4ec416260ade19ecbc7557f908c81e6
1 Input
1 Output
-
80bb192d04370398f64dd37a4be8fa72f4ec416260ade19ecbc7557f908c81e6:0
- value
- 29997230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1ea2bf47d9bf6a0c6a85dd4c2abbef919573cb5 OP_EQUAL
- address
- 3NHYVEuLcDMFmMCT6m3Msz57Z8Xk2UzqL1